Very disturbing Event

It's a disturbing event with real ramifications, when sections of the Australian military spy on their own elected government minister, apparently without authorisation.
This is the sort of thing that happens in some third world countries, where even military coups are common.
It is unacceptable in Australia for some military personnel to disregard our system of government and feel they can apparently act above the law.
Whatever the minister has done or not done, is not the point. It is the breach of protocol that creates a precedent we Australians should just not tolerate.
